“After that the centre-stage was seized by tall blonde Canadian soprano Barbara Hannigan. Before the interval, she embodied the tragic, despairing, put-upon soldier’s wife of Berg’s opera Wozzeck, singing a lullaby to her child. After the interval, she was the crazed Chief of Police, Gepopo, from Ligeti’s absurdist opera Le Grand Macabre, dressed in the schoolgirl pigtails and micro-skirt beloved of certain top-shelf magazines.
Going to extremes suits the brilliant, somewhat brittle Hannigan to a tee. She carried off this transformation with perfect aplomb, while managing the insanely difficult pyrotechnics of Ligeti’s score.”
– The Telegraph, January 2015
